/**
* Result of validating and decoding a minimal Unicode code unit sequence.
* Returned from validating Unicode string code point iterators.
* Adds function wellFormed() to base class UnsafeCodeUnits.
*
* @tparam UnitIter An iterator (often a pointer) that returns a code unit type:
* UTF-8: char or char8_t or uint8_t;
* UTF-16: char16_t or uint16_t or (on Windows) wchar_t
* @tparam CP32 Code point type: UChar32 (=int32_t) or char32_t or uint32_t;
* should be signed if U_BEHAVIOR_NEGATIVE
* @see UTFIterator
* @see UTFStringCodePoints
* @draft ICU 78
*/
template<typename UnitIter, typename CP32, typename = void>
class CodeUnits : public UnsafeCodeUnits<UnitIter, CP32> {
public:
// @internal
CodeUnits(CP32 codePoint, uint8_t length, bool wellFormed, UnitIter data) :
UnsafeCodeUnits<UnitIter, CP32>(codePoint, length, data), ok(wellFormed) {}
CodeUnits(const CodeUnits &other) = default;
CodeUnits &operator=(const CodeUnits &other) = default;
bool wellFormed() const { return ok; }
private:
bool ok;
};
